
Bunk Bed Mattresses
Bunk beds are popular bed choices, especially for parents who want their kids to
share rooms. Aside from choosing the frame, picking the right bunk bed mattresses is important, especially since
this can determine whether the person sleeping on the bed will have a good night's rest or not. This article talks
about the things that you will need to consider in choosing the bunk bed mattresses for your home.
Size of Mattress
Size is the most important factor that you will need to consider in shopping for bunk
bed mattresses. Don't assume that just because the salesman calls the mattress standard sized means that it's
automatically the right size for your bed. If you're shopping for mattresses separately from the bed, make sure
that you measure the bed frame first to ensure that you are getting one that is the right size.
It's not just about the width of the bunk bed mattresses though. A
mattress that is too high can go beyond the guard rail of the bed, providing a greater chance of the person using
the bed to roll off the side while he or she is sleeping. At the same time, a mattress that is too low can also be
dangerous especially if small children will be using the bed, since they can slip between the mattress and the
guard rail and fall through the gap.
Durability of the Mattress
Make sure that the bunk bed mattresses you'll be getting are durable
as well. Ask about the padding of the mattress. If it's too thin or is made of materials that have poor quality,
the mattress will be more liable to sag quickly. Make inquiries about the stitching as well. This is particularly
important if children will be the ones who will be using the mattresses, since kids' beds take a lot of abuse.
These mattresses will need to be able to withstand the weight of kids as they jump up and down on it.
Type of Mattress
There are actually two types of mattresses that you can choose from.
Innerspring mattresses are the common types of mattresses, filled with springs and padding inside to support the
ones who will be sleeping on these. Foam mattresses, on the other hand, make use of memory foam that conforms to
the shape and form of the people sleeping on it, ensuring a comfortable night's sleep.
